Area of interest: Cholesterol and triglycerides Supplement based on maple, artichoke and other herbal extracts. Maple supports liver function and metabolism. cholesterol; choline and artichoke together with fenugreek and mistletoe, contribute to normal lipid metabolism (triglycerides And cholesterol) and act in combination with maple; furthermore, choline and artichoke promote the maintenance of regular liver function; the artichoke also promotes the purifying functions of the organism, with fenugreek and maple helps the digestive function and together with the mistletoe it plays aantioxidant action. Finally, fenugreek plays aemollient and soothing action on the digestive system while vitamin C contributes to the cell protection from oxidative stress and to normal energy metabolism. How to use It is recommended to take 10 ml diluted in a glass of water, once or twice daily at any time (10 to 20 ml per day). If desired, the daily dose can be diluted in a bottle of water to be consumed throughout the day. Shake before use. Graduated measuring cup included in the package. Keep the product out of the refrigerator even after opening. Nutritional table Legend EIS= Dry whole extract. EIL= Liquid whole extract. NRV= Nutrient Reference Value. Ingredients Bidistilled vegetable glycerin, pure water, choline tartrate, rose hip (Dog rose) EIS fruits (titrated at 50% in vitamin C), artichoke (Scolymus cynara) EIL leaves, field maple (Maple campestris) glyceric macerate of fresh buds, fenugreek (Trigonella foenum-graecum) EIL seeds, mistletoe (Viscum album) EIL leaves and twigs; natural sweeteners: steviol glycosides from stevia, thaumatin. With natural sweeteners. Line Gold Line Additional Information EIS= Dry whole extractThe extraction of the plants carried out by us in the company is carried out under vacuum and at low temperature to preserve all the active and nutritional principles intact, that is the phytocomplex; on average from 4 kg of plants we obtain 1 kg of dry extract (4:1). Any variations in the colour of the tablets between different batches of the product reflect the natural ones of the plants used, in absence of principles of synthesis.EIL= Liquid whole extractThe extraction of the plants carried out by us in the company is carried out under vacuum and at low temperature to preserve all the active and nutritional ingredients intact, i.e. the phytocomplex. The possible presence of resins and essential oils on the surface and/or sediment on the bottom are an indication of the quality of the product, in fact they constitute the fraction insoluble in water of the phytocomplex.Free from animal derived ingredients." Warnings Supplements are not intended as a substitute for a varied and balanced diet and should be used as part of a healthy lifestyle. Do not exceed the recommended daily dose. The product should be kept out of reach of children under three years of age.

Area of interest: Intestinal well-being Buckthorn, cascara and rhubarb promote the regularity of intestinal transit. Gentian, cinnamon and cloves promote the elimination of gas intestinal and, together with liquorice, they are useful for supporting the digestive function. How to use It is recommended to take from 1 to 4 grains in the evening before dinner or before going to bed (1 to 4 grains per day). Close carefully after use. Nutritional table Legend Plv= Powder. SD= Dehydrated juice. Ingredients Buckthorn (Rhamnus frangula) bark Plv, cascara (Rhamnus purshiana) Plv bark, licorice (Glycyrrhiza glabra) SD roots (titrated at 3-4% in glycyrrhizic acid or glycyrrhizin), cinnamon (Cinnamon zeylanicum) Plv bark, cloves (Eugenia caryophyllata) flower buds Plv, gentian (Gentian yellow) Plv roots, Chinese rhubarb (Rheum palmatum) rhizomes Plv. 100% product. Line Gold Line Additional Information Free from animal derived ingredients. Warnings Supplements are not intended as a substitute for a varied and balanced diet and should be used as part of a healthy lifestyle. Do not exceed the recommended daily dose. The product should be kept out of reach of children under three years of age. Do not administer to children under 12 years of age. Consult your doctor if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Do not use for prolonged periods without consulting your doctor.
